list revision 1.10
11.10Ssimonb# $NetBSD: list,v 1.10 1999/12/28 10:46:55 simonb Exp $ 21.1Sjonathan 31.1Sjonathan# pmax extra's: mountpoint for kernfs 41.1SjonathanSPECIAL mkdir kern 51.1Sjonathan 61.1Sjonathan# extras in bin 71.1SjonathanLINK instbin bin/csh 81.1SjonathanLINK instbin bin/date 91.1SjonathanLINK instbin bin/rcp 101.1SjonathanLINK instbin bin/rcmd 111.1Sjonathan 121.1Sjonathan# extras in sbin 131.1SjonathanLINK instbin sbin/disklabel 141.1SjonathanLINK instbin sbin/mount_ext2fs 151.1SjonathanLINK instbin sbin/fsck_ext2fs 161.1SjonathanLINK instbin sbin/mount_kernfs 171.1Sjonathan 181.1Sjonathan# extras in /usr.bin 191.1SjonathanSYMLINK ../../instbin usr/bin/netstat 201.1SjonathanSYMLINK ../../instbin usr/bin/rsh 211.1SjonathanSYMLINK ../../instbin usr/bin/tset usr/bin/reset 221.1SjonathanSYMLINK ../../instbin usr/bin/vi 231.10Ssimonb 241.10Ssimonb# extras in /usr/mdec 251.10SsimonbSYMLINK ../../instbin usr/mdec/installboot 261.2Sjonathan 271.2Sjonathan# OK, now do everything in /usr all over all again in usr.install, 281.2Sjonathan# in case we try and install directly into the miniroot (mounting over /usr). 291.2Sjonathan 301.2Sjonathan# local usr.bin 311.2SjonathanSPECIAL mkdir usr.install 321.2SjonathanSPECIAL mkdir usr.install/bin 331.2SjonathanSPECIAL mkdir usr.install/sbin 341.2Sjonathan 351.2Sjonathan 361.2SjonathanSPECIAL ln -s ../../instbin usr.install/bin/chflags 371.2SjonathanSPECIAL ln -s ../../instbin usr.install/bin/chgrp 381.2SjonathanSPECIAL ln -s ../../instbin usr.install/bin/ftp 391.2SjonathanSPECIAL ln -s ../../instbin usr.install/bin/gunzip 401.2SjonathanSPECIAL ln -s ../../instbin usr.install/bin/gzcat 411.2SjonathanSPECIAL ln -s ../../instbin usr.install/bin/gzip 421.2SjonathanSPECIAL ln -s ../../instbin usr.install/bin/netstat 431.2SjonathanSPECIAL ln -s ../../instbin usr.install/bin/sort 441.2SjonathanSPECIAL ln -s ../../instbin usr.install/bin/tar 451.2SjonathanSPECIAL ln -s ../../instbin usr.install/bin/tip 461.2SjonathanSPECIAL ln -s ../../instbin usr.install/bin/vi 471.2Sjonathan 481.2Sjonathan# local usr.sbin 491.2SjonathanSPECIAL ln -s ../../instbin usr.install/sbin/chroot 501.2SjonathanSPECIAL ln -s ../../instbin usr.install/sbin/chown 511.1Sjonathan 521.1Sjonathan 531.1Sjonathan# crunchgen source directory specials: progs built in nonstandard places 541.1SjonathanCRUNCHSPECIAL vi srcdir usr.bin/vi/build 551.1SjonathanCRUNCHSPECIAL sysinst srcdir distrib/utils/sysinst/arch/pmax 561.1Sjonathan 571.1Sjonathan 581.1Sjonathan 591.1Sjonathan# Minimize use of MFS 601.1SjonathanSYMLINK /tmp var/tmp 611.1Sjonathan 621.1Sjonathan# copy the MAKEDEV script and make some devices 631.1SjonathanCOPY ${DESTDIR}/dev/MAKEDEV dev/MAKEDEV 641.1SjonathanCOPY ${DESTDIR}/dev/MAKEDEV.local dev/MAKEDEV.local 651.1SjonathanSPECIAL cd dev; sh MAKEDEV all 661.1SjonathanSPECIAL /bin/rm dev/MAKEDEV dev/MAKEDEV.local 671.1Sjonathan 681.1Sjonathan# we need the contents of /usr/mdec 691.7SsimonbCOPYDIR ${DESTDIR}/usr/mdec usr/mdec 701.7Ssimonb# and /boot 711.7SsimonbCOPY ${DESTDIR}/boot boot 721.1Sjonathan 731.1Sjonathan 741.1Sjonathan# the zoneinfo (dont use) 751.1Sjonathan#COPYDIR ${DESTDIR}/usr/share/zoneinfo usr/share/zoneinfo 761.1Sjonathan 771.1Sjonathan# a subset termcap file 781.1SjonathanCOPY ${ARCHDIR}/termcap.rcons usr/share/misc/termcap 791.1Sjonathan 801.1Sjonathan# copy the kernel(s) 811.1SjonathanCOPY ${CURDIR}/../../sys/arch/pmax/compile/GENERIC/netbsd.aout netbsd 821.1SjonathanCOPY ${CURDIR}/../../sys/arch/pmax/compile/GENERIC/netbsd.ecoff netbsd.ecoff 831.4SsimonbCOPY ${CURDIR}/../../sys/arch/pmax/compile/INSTALL/nfsnetbsd.ecoff nfsnetbsd.ecoff 841.1Sjonathan 851.1Sjonathan# various files that we need in /etc for the install 861.3Sjonathan#COPY ${DESTDIR}/etc/disktab etc/disktab.shadow 871.3Sjonathan#SYMLINK /tmp/disktab.shadow etc/disktab 881.3Sjonathan#SYMLINK /tmp/fstab.shadow etc/fstab 891.3Sjonathan#SYMLINK /tmp/resolv.conf.shadow etc/resolv.conf 901.3Sjonathan#SYMLINK /tmp/hosts etc/hosts 911.3Sjonathan 921.3Sjonathan# sysinst needs disktab template 931.3SjonathanCOPY ${DESTDIR}/etc/disktab etc/disktab.preinstall 941.1Sjonathan 951.1Sjonathan# and the installation tools 961.1SjonathanCOPY ${ARCHDIR}/dot.profile .profile 971.1SjonathanLINK instbin sbin/sysinst 981.4Ssimonb 991.4Ssimonb# and a spare .profile 1001.4SsimonbCOPY ${DESTDIR}/.profile tmp/.hdprofile 1011.8Sbouyer 1021.8Sbouyer#the lists of obsolete files used by sysinst 1031.8SbouyerSPECIAL sh ${CURDIR}/../../../../distrib/sets/makeobsolete -b -s ${CURDIR}/../../../distrib/sets -t ./dist 104